Schedule Information

The Eiffel Tower operates year-round, but its hours may vary depending on the season. Here’s a general schedule to keep in mind:

  • Opening Hours: Generally opens at 9:30 AM.
  • Closing Hours: Closes at 11:45 PM, with the last elevator ride at 11:00 PM.
  • Peak Season: During summer months, the tower may remain open until midnight.

Getting There

The Eiffel Tower is centrally located in Paris, making it accessible via various modes of transportation. Here are some options:

Transportation Method Description Estimated Cost Travel Time
Metro Take Line 6 to Bir-Hakeim station or Line 9 to Trocadéro station. €1.90 10-15 minutes from central Paris
Walking Enjoy a scenic walk from nearby attractions like the Champs de Mars or Trocadéro. Free 15-30 minutes, depending on your starting point
Bicycle Rent a bike through the Vélib’ system for a fun ride. €1.70 for a day pass Varies

Accessibility Information

The Eiffel Tower is designed to accommodate visitors of all abilities:

  • Elevator Access: Elevators are available to take you to the second floor and summit, making it accessible for those with mobility challenges.
  • Stairs: For the adventurous, there are 1,665 steps to the summit. However, only the first two floors are accessible by stairs.
